Reset Oil Change Warning Lights 2014 Push to Start or Key-Less Enter and Go Vehicles

If this has already been posted then please delete it.

I was helping a member out on another forum earlier and ran into an issue on how to reset Warning Lights on a 2014 with Push to Start or Key-Less enter and go vehicles. After doing a little research I found a solution.

Vehicles Equipped With Keyless Enter-N-Go™
1. Without pressing the brake pedal, press the ENGINE
START/STOP button and cycle the ignition to the
ON/ RUN position (Do not start the engine.)
2. Fully depress the accelerator pedal, slowly, three times
within 10 seconds.
3. Without pressing the brake pedal, press the ENGINE
START/STOP button once to return the ignition to the
OFF/LOCK position.

***NOTE: This comes straight out of the User Manual which is downloaded from the Ram website***

Are you asking if this is right... or decript it for you?

Not sure what your asking? Push buttons can also be used with the fob. Just pop the start button off at the bottom and insert key fob.

That's just incase the battery dies in the fob for the security system. There's a key in the fob as well to unlock the door for the same reason.

Not sure if that's what you need?

My Challenger is push start, so that's how I know.

In the 6 speeds you need to depress the clutch when you press the start button to start the engin. Otherwise it cycles to "ACC" and the "Start" position. 3rd press gets you to start.

Auto's I think you have to press the brake when you hit the start button I think. Mine a 6 speed.

Clearing the codes is the same way. Don't press the brake and press the start button twice to get it into the start position... then press the gas peddle... just like getting rid of the oil change reminder.
